How Reliable is the Suzuki Liana?

Based on 173,088 MOT tests across 11,764 vehicles.

73.6%
Pass Rate
5,694
Miles/Year
25
Year Lifespan
11,764
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 9,027
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 4,766
constant velocity joint gaiter damaged to the extent that it no longer prevents the ingress of dirt etc 4,309
Brake pipe excessively corroded 4,061
Suspension arm has excessive play in a ball joint 3,736

BK52 JOU is a 2002 Suzuki Liana in Silver with a 1,586c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 68.2%.

Across all 2002 Suzuki Liana models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.7% with a typical mileage of 61,454 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Suzuki Liana f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 9,027 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BK52 JOU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Suzuki Liana typ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 24 years old, this Suzuki Liana is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
